About The Position

The Manufacturing Engineer Manager will lead assembly, integration and test flows for space hardware builds. This individual will work closely with and manage engineering and manufacturing teams to integrate Kuiper satellites with dispenser and launch vehicle hardware. The Manufacturing Engineer Manager is a technical leader of the team, providing guidance on many aspects including but not limited to testing requirements, assembly/integration workcell design within the payload processing facilities, facility and equipment planning, integration and test application implementation and improvement, process control, design for manufacturability, project management, and tooling design. The ideal candidate is comfortable in a highly technical setting and leads collaboration with other departments to reach the best solution to any problem and is able to technically challenge assumptions and requirements of these departments, such as dynamics and thermal analysis, design engineering, and tooling engineering. Additionally, a Manufacturing Engineer Manager is expected to set objectives for the team overall, not only identifying the right long term strategies but implementing them on their assemblies and responsibilities, leading by example first and then by instruction. They'll have extensive experience in space hardware integration and test, with particular focus on satellite to dispenser and/or launch vehicle integration.

Responsibilities

  • Working with engineering teams – plan and optimize workstation layouts for Assembly, Integration & Test (AIT), to intended throughput capacities.
  • Material flow planning and manufacturing process definition – spacecraft and dispenser level, assembly & test.
  • Implement and continuously improve assembly, integration and test processes
  • Specify and procure various assembly equipment and systems to meet program development requirements
  • Interface with facilities personnel in site usage and integration flow.
  • AIT takt time & cost optimization planning
  • Definition & implementation of Work Order and automated documentation processes.
  • Payload compliance certification sign-off
  • Anomaly resolution and corrective action implementation
